Drive just 45 miles north west of New York City and you will find
Greenwood Lake
Greenwood Lake is a nine mile lake (the largest in Orange County) that provides all recreational opportunities including fishing (tournament, also), boating, pontoon boat sales and rentals, water skiing, swimming, ice fishing, ice skating, a water taxi that goes to and from lakefront restaurants, and jet skiing. Some yearly area events (subject to change) include a decorated boat parade, sailing regattas, a triathlon, an Independence Day fireworks display, weekly summer movies and concerts in the park, a Farmers’ Market, dinner cruises, a Fall Festival event on the main street, and much more.
